Responsible Use of AI in Corporate Reporting: Insights and Recommendations
In collaboration with Insig AI, Falcon Windsor presents a research paper titled "Your Precocious Intern," aimed at providing a practical model for the responsible use of AI in corporate reporting. This paper analyzes AI adoption across UK companies, specifically focusing on the FTSE 350, and reveals the rising use of generative AI tools in reporting without adequate oversight or training. Wiley and AWS Launch Generative AI Agent for Scientific Literature Search
In a groundbreaking move for scientific research and publishing, Wiley one of the world’s largest publishers, has partnered with Amazon Web Services (AWS) to launch a generative AI agent for scientific literature search. This marks the first time a publisher has released such an agent on AWS, expanding access to comprehensive, full-text literature discovery.
